See all selected deals in Amsterdam. Click here!
Parkhotel Horst
Tienrayseweg 2, Horst

Enjoy a stay in the unique Parkhotel in Horst. The hotel is located in a recreational area in Horst, close to Venlo in the northern part of the province of Limburg. The building resembles a castle and is beautifully situated by the water amidst woody surroundings. All rooms and almost all other areas in the hotel offer a view of the lake. The hotel is easy to reach by car (exit 10 on the A73 motorway) and offers free parking.